OAUSTECH 2025 Post-UTME and Direct Entry Screening Guide

Who Can Apply?

Olusegun Agagu University of Science and Technology (OAUSTECH), Okitipupa, Ondo State, has started screening for 2025 UTME and Direct Entry applicants.

If you made OAUSTECH your first choice and scored 150 or higher in the 2025 UTME, you are eligible. If you didn’t pick the university before, you’ll need to log into the JAMB portal and switch OAUSTECH to your first choice.

Every applicant must have five credit passes, including English and Mathematics, in no more than two sittings.

How To Apply

Step-by-step:

  1. Visit OAUSTECH’s official site
  2. Or go directly to the application portal
  3. Use your valid UTME or Direct Entry registration number to create an account
  4. Pay ₦2,000 using any ATM card on the portal
  5. After payment, the system redirects you to complete the form stage by stage
  6. Fill out your details carefully, upload the needed documents
  7. Print your form and keep it safe, you’ll need it on the exam day
